Exploring the theme of thematic tastings, some wineries curate experiences round particular grape varieties, areas, or production strategies. For instance, a vertical tasting would possibly contain sampling several vintages of the identical wine to explore its evolution over time. This format promotes appreciation for subtleties and depth within a single varietal, providing a deeper understanding of getting older processes.

Conversely, horizontal tastings evaluate different wines made from the same grape in numerous regions or styles. This technique highlights how terroir influences the flavour profiles, showcasing the range and flexibility of that grape.
